Fair Lady wallflower seeds for bright borders
wallflower seeds ‘Fair Lady’ are a classic choice for colourful spring displays, offering a rich mix of clear, bright tones that suit many garden styles. This biennial flower is widely used as a spring flowering bedding plant, bringing reliable colour to borders, edging, and mixed planting schemes. The variety is also known as Erysimum cheiri, a traditional cottage garden favourite that pairs especially well with late-flowering spring bulbs for layered interest.
Colourful biennial flowers with sweet fragrance
‘Fair Lady’ produces abundant blooms and is valued as one of the more fragrant garden flower seeds for seasonal scent in outdoor spaces. The upright habit reaches around 45 cm in height, making it easy to combine with other biennial flower seeds and compact perennials without overwhelming nearby plants. Site preference and garden design combinations
These erysimum cheiri seeds are suitable for a light position and can also be used as wallflower seeds for partial shade, especially where the site still receives some sun during the day. In garden design, they work well in groups for impact, along paths, or in front of taller plants.
